Actuarial Science Salary in Lafayette (COL-Adjusted)

Salaries adjusted for Lafayette's cost of living index of 104 (national average = 100).

Entry Level (0-2 yrs)
$52,000(+$2,000 vs national)
Mid Career (5-9 yrs)
$124,800(+$4,800 vs national)
Senior Level (15+ yrs)
$161,200(+$6,200 vs national)

Note: National average Actuarial Science salary: $50,000 starting, $120,000 mid-career, $155,000 senior level.Lafayette adjustment factor: 1.04x based on the local cost of living index.
